What Are The Materials For Sculpture. The main ones are clay, plaster, and wax; An enormous variety of media may be used, including clay, wax, stone, metal, fabric, glass, wood, plaster, rubber, and random “found” objects. Sculptors use metal tools and abrasives to create figures, reliefs, or abstract forms. Sculptors would traditionally use clay, stone, metal, plastic, wood, glass, or fabric, among other materials, to create a work of art. But concrete, synthetic resins, plastic wood, stucco, and even molten metal can also be modeled. Clay is one of the most popular materials for sculpting, as it is readily available, easy to manipulate, and allows for a great deal of detail.
